Review

This Goodman dual-fuel system combines a 100,000 BTU furnace with a 2-ton cooling condenser in an upflow A-Coil configuration. Positioned as a mid-market offering from Online Supply, it targets homeowners seeking balanced heating and cooling without premium pricing. The system includes two-stage operation on both the furnace burners and condenser, allowing it to modulate output based on demand rather than running at full capacity constantly.

Cooling delivers 16 SEER efficiency with a 24,000 BTU capacity, meeting Energy Star standards. The furnace achieves 80% AFUE for natural gas or propane heating, recovering most combustion heat for distribution. A scroll compressor and variable-speed blower motor running at 2000 CFM maximum provide smooth operation. The unit requires 120V single-phase power with a 15.8 to 25 amp breaker, standard for residential installations. Two-stage operation reduces the 72 dBA noise level compared to single-stage units running continuously.

Installation

This upflow system needs metal exhaust flue and fits standard A-Coil spaces found in many homes. Liquid and suction lines use standard 3/8 inch and 3/4 inch sweat valves with 50 feet of pre-insulated suction line included. Dimensions of 34.5 inches high by 21 inches wide by 28.75 inches deep fit typical furnace closets. Electrical hookup is straightforward 120V single-phase 60 Hz, making it accessible for most HVAC contractors.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does this unit actually have 2 tons or 3 tons of cooling capacity? +
The specs show conflicting data: the title states 2 tons, but the tonnage field lists 3 tons, with cooling BTU at 24,000 (which equals 2 tons). Clarify this discrepancy with your supplier before purchase to ensure proper sizing for your home's square footage and insulation.
What's required to install this in an existing furnace location? +
You need a metal exhaust flue, standard electrical outlet for 120V, and refrigerant lines sized for 3/8 inch liquid and 3/4 inch suction connections. The included 50-foot insulated suction line covers most residential runs. Professional installation is recommended to ensure proper gas line sizing and refrigerant charge.
How much will heating and cooling cost to operate monthly? +
At 80% AFUE furnace efficiency and 16 SEER cooling, operating costs depend on your fuel prices and climate. Generally, expect moderate expenses for moderate climates. Two-stage operation reduces waste versus single-stage units, saving roughly 10 to 15 percent on blended seasonal costs compared to older systems.
How does the 16 SEER rating compare to newer high-efficiency options? +
16 SEER meets Energy Star standards but sits below premium units offering 18 to 24 SEER. For moderate climates with balanced heating and cooling demand, 16 SEER delivers solid efficiency gains. In hot climates, consider 18+ SEER options if your cooling season is intense.
